Blackmagic Unveils Customizable URSA Cine 12K Body for $6,995

Blackmagic Design introduces a stripped-down version of its high-end URSA Cine 12K camera, offering a more affordable option for experienced cinematographers and rental houses. The new Blackmagic URSA Cine 12K LF Body maintains the same quality and features as the full kit but excludes many accessories, allowing users to customize their setup with existing gear.

For reference, here’s the URSA Cine 12K in its full setup.

Behind the Scenes

  • Priced at $6,995, the body-only model offers significant savings compared to the full kit

  • Includes a dual CFexpress media module instead of the 8TB module found in the full kit

  • Features the same 12K large format RGBW 36 x 24mm sensor with 16 stops of dynamic range

  • Capable of shooting up to 80 fps in 12K, 144 fps in 8K, and 240 fps in 4K

  • Comes with an EF lens mount, with PL and LPL mounts available separately

  • Retains industry-standard connections like Lemo and Fischer for accessories and remote control

  • Includes built-in hardware for RTMP and SRT live streaming

Final Take

This move by Blackmagic Design caters to the growing demand for modular camera systems in the film industry. By offering a high-end camera body at a lower price point, the company is making its advanced technology more accessible to a broader range of filmmakers and production companies.

This strategy could potentially increase market share and foster greater adoption of Blackmagic's ecosystem in professional filmmaking circles.
